Paul Onuachu

Super Eagle Striker,  Paul Onuachu netted two goals for Genk, a Belgian Club in a 2-1 victory against Kortrijk over the weekend on Saturday, 8th October 2022. 

He acknowledged in an interview after the match that the  Smurfs were the better team during the first half but they missed several good chances to net goals. 

About his second goal against Kortrijk – a penalty he netted – he however expressed feeling better in the system.

 Thanks to Onuachu, Genk will stay second on the Belgian FDA table, two points behind Antwerp. 

From track records both on his national team and international appearances, Onuachu is that prolific scorer that will always give outstanding results.

Josh Maja

In September 2019, Josh Maja made his international debut playing for the Nigerian national team in a friendly match against Ukraine. 

He represented the Super Eagles Gernot Rohr. 

Despite the initial criticism against him in the League, Maja has gone on to prove critics wrong by bagging his sixth goal in five games of the season in the 2022/2023 season. 

In a match against Metz on Saturday, 8 October, Maja’s team Bordeaux won 2-0. 

Ademola Lookman

Ademola Lookman is eligible to play for the national team of both England and Nigeria. 

He was born in England to both Nigerian parents. 24-years old Lookman has scored two consecutive goals for Atlanta, in crucial games.

 Recently, In a 2-2 draw against Udinese, Lookman scored for Atlanta. Pending the result of Napoli’s fixture at Cremonese, this win takes Atlanta to the top of series A. 

Terem Moffi 

Terem Moffi plays as a forward for Lorient, Ligue 1 club. The last seven games for Lorient have seen Moffi netting eight goals for Lorient.

 Régis Le Bris, Lorient’s manager, expressed his assurance of Moffi’s quality in becoming Europe’s most coveted forwards. 

On Sunday, 9th of October 2022, Moffi scored a double against Brest, which makes it his eighth goal of the season. 

Kenneth Omeruo 

Omeruo currently plays as a defender for Leganes. 

He was a key part of the Super Eagles team that won the bronze medal in 2019 against Tunisia. In a recent 2-1 win over Cartagena, Omeruo scored a goal for Leganes. 

However, in their last four games, Omeruo alongside his teammates has failed to win any of their last four games.
